Robin Sadler (born March 31, 1955) is a Canadian former professional ice hockey defenceman. He was drafted in the first round, ninth overall, of the 1975 NHL Amateur Draft by the Montreal Canadiens; in addition, he was drafted in the second round, 18th overall, of the 1975 WHA Amateur Draft by the Michigan Stags. However, Sadler never played in either the National Hockey League or the World Hockey Association.
